Harissa is prepared and served to customers on a cold winter day in Srinagar, Jammu and Kashmir, India, on December 20, 2024. This traditional mutton curry is usually eaten with a Kashmiri bread called tchot. Slow-cooked over hours, the main ingredient of this textural dish is sheep or goat meat, cooked with short-grained rice and flavored with spices such as fennel seeds, cinnamon, and cardamom.

A chef is serving Harissa to customers on a cold morning in Srinagar, Kashmir, India, on January 18, 2024. Harissa is a unique, age-old mutton recipe prepared during the winter in Kashmir, typically available in the morning hours and made from sheep mutton. The mutton is first cooked at a mild temperature until it is boneless, then mixed with rice flour, water, and various spices, and constantly stirred until it becomes squashy. People often enjoy this dish with baked bread.
